Core competencies 1
Make ethical decisions by applying standards of the National Association of Social Workers Code of
Ethics and, as applicable, of the International Federation of Social Workers/International Association
of Schools of Social Work Ethics in Social Work, Statement of Principles.
One thing that the agency does to ensure that they are abiding by the NASW Code of Ethics is require every
staff member and volunteer to read manuals. I had to read and sign forms to confirm that I understand the
rules/ handbook. This will help me as I work with clients because I will be able to accurately service them. I
also abide by their confidentiality while at the shelter I do not give out information to other clients. If a client
shares personal information with me I respect that and keep it confidential. I empower the women for
example a client asked me if they had to stay in the shelter for 30 days, I let her know that she can make that
decision on her own and that she can do what she feels is best for her.

Give clients who exit the shelter surveys that have questions about the
services that were provided for them during their stay. This provides
information for demographics , and grants. Also do follow up with
clients after they have left the shelter and have been gone for 30 days.
